Understanding the Fundamentals of Futures Contracts
At its heart, futures trading involves agreements to buy or sell an asset at a predetermined price on a specified future date. These assets can range from commodities like oil and gold to financial instruments like stocks and currencies. The price of a futures contract is determined by supply and demand, reflecting the market’s expectations about the future value of the underlying asset. Traders aim to profit from correctly anticipating these price movements. The concept is simple: buy low, sell high, or sell high, buy low, depending on your prediction of the future price.
One critical aspect of futures trading is the concept of leverage. Because futures contracts are relatively inexpensive to control, traders can exert significant influence over a large asset value with a relatively small initial investment, called margin. While leverage can amplify potential profits, it also magnifies potential losses. This is why risk management is paramount in futures trading. Traders must carefully assess their risk tolerance and implement strategies to limit potential downside exposure. Understanding margin requirements, position sizing, and stop-loss orders are crucial components of successful futures trading.

The Mechanics of Event Contracts on Kalshi
Event contracts on kalshi are structured differently than traditional futures contracts. Instead of directly betting on the outcome of an event, traders buy and sell contracts that represent a probability of that event occurring. The price of a contract reflects the market’s collective belief about the likelihood of the event. As new information emerges and opinions shift, the contract price fluctuates accordingly. The payout structure is designed to be straightforward: if the event occurs, contracts that predicted the outcome pay out $1.00 per contract. If the event does not occur, the contracts expire worthless.
This structure allows traders to express their views on the probability of an event occurring and profit from correctly anticipating the outcome. It also enables traders to hedge against potential risks. For example, a political campaign might use kalshi to hedge against the risk of losing an election. By buying contracts that predict their opponent’s victory, they can offset potential losses if their opponent wins. The versatility of event contracts makes kalshi a valuable tool for both speculation and risk management.

Understanding Implied Probability and Market Liquidity
Understanding implied probability is essential for assessing the value of kalshi contracts. The price of a contract reflects the market’s implied probability of the event occurring. For example, a contract trading at $0.70 implies that the market believes there is a 70% chance of the event occurring. Comparing the implied probability to your own assessment of the event’s likelihood can help you identify potential trading opportunities. If you believe the market is underestimating the probability of an event, you might consider buying the contract. Conversely, if you believe the market is overestimating the probability, you might consider selling.
Market liquidity is another important factor to consider. Contracts with high trading volume and tight bid-ask spreads are generally more liquid, making it easier to enter and exit positions without significantly impacting the price. Be cautious when trading contracts with low liquidity, as you may encounter difficulties finding buyers or sellers at your desired price. Monitoring market liquidity indicators and avoiding illiquid contracts can help reduce your trading risk.
